Hit up Dram Shop on Broadway last Friday—grabbed a $6 PBR tallboy and a $8 whiskey neat. Laid-back dive vibes with that classic jukebox blasting old-school Steely Dan and Beastie Boys—real talk, it hits different. Bartenders were chill, regulars were chatting it up, TVs showed the game. Spent about $15. Cozy, no‑frills spot—perfect for a quick, honest drink. Will be back!

Dram Shop is the kind of place that feels like a hidden gem in Lakeview. Tucked away on Broadway, it's got that old-school tavern vibe—dimly lit, jukebox rocking everything from Steely Dan to the Beastie Boys, and a crowd that feels like family. Brad behind the bar is a legend—always remembers your name, cracks a joke, and keeps the drinks flowing. I stopped by with a buddy, grabbed a couple of PBRs for $2 each, and tossed a few bucks in the jukebox. We didn't order food this time, but the place is known for its chill, no-frills atmosphere. If you're looking for a spot that's low-key, dog-friendly, and full of character, Dram Shop is the move.

Old school dive bar with 100+ whiskeys and where the bartender working knew all of the regulars names, what could be better?
Came on a Saturday at 1p and it was busy, not hard to look busy for a small place but the service was super quick. Each whiskey pour we had was $7.50 which was insane, great spot if you want to watch a game and hang out sampling whiskeys and chatting with the super friendly bartender.

If you like small, dark, dive bars, this is your place! Don’t be put off by how hole-in-the-wall it is though, they have a great whiskey selection and friendly service. It’s a great stop along Broadway for an Old Style or a Chicago Handshake!
